Pairing in asymmetric two-component fermion matter

Soft Condensed Matter 2009-11-07 v1 Superconductivity

Abstract

We analyze the possibilities of pairing between two different fermion species in asymmetric matter at low density. While the direct interaction allows pairing only for very small asymmetries, the pairing mediated by polarization effects is always possible, with a pronounced maximum at finite asymmetry. We present analytical results up to second order in the low-density parameter kFak_F a.
